// XXX shouldn't this get moved to color code?
static const char* RGBToCSSString(nscolor aColor)
{
const char* result = nsnull;
PRInt32 r = NS_GET_R(aColor);
PRInt32 g = NS_GET_G(aColor);
PRInt32 b = NS_GET_B(aColor);
PRInt32 index = 0;
PRInt32 count = sizeof(css_rgb_table)/sizeof(CSSColorEntry);
CSSColorEntry* entry = nsnull;
for (index = 0; index < count; index++)
{
entry = &css_rgb_table[index];
if (entry->r == r)
{
if (entry->g == g && entry->b == b)
{
result = entry->name;
break;
}
}
else if (entry->r > r)
{
break;
}
}
return result;
}
void ValueToString(const nsCSSValue& aValue, PRInt32 aPropID, nsString& aBuffer)
{
nsCSSUnit unit = aValue.GetUnit();
if (eCSSUnit_Null == unit) {
return;
}
if (eCSSUnit_String == unit) {
nsAutoString buffer;
aValue.GetStringValue(buffer);
aBuffer.Append(buffer);
}
else if (eCSSUnit_Integer == unit) {
aBuffer.Append(aValue.GetIntValue(), 10);
}
else if (eCSSUnit_Enumerated == unit) {
const char* name = nsCSSProps::LookupProperty(aPropID, aValue.GetIntValue());
if (name != nsnull) {
aBuffer.Append(name);
}
}
else if (eCSSUnit_Color == unit){
nscolor color = aValue.GetColorValue();
const char* name = RGBToCSSString(color);
if (name != nsnull)
aBuffer.Append(name);
else
{
aBuffer.Append("rgb(");
aBuffer.Append(NS_GET_R(color), 10);
aBuffer.Append(",");
aBuffer.Append(NS_GET_G(color), 10);
aBuffer.Append(",");
aBuffer.Append(NS_GET_B(color), 10);
aBuffer.Append(')');
}
}
else if (eCSSUnit_Percent == unit) {
aBuffer.Append(aValue.GetFloatValue() * 100.0f);
}
else if (eCSSUnit_Percent < unit) { // length unit
aBuffer.Append(aValue.GetFloatValue());
}
switch (unit) {
case eCSSUnit_Null: break;
case eCSSUnit_Auto: aBuffer.Append("auto"); break;
case eCSSUnit_Inherit: aBuffer.Append("inherit"); break;
case eCSSUnit_None: aBuffer.Append("none"); break;
case eCSSUnit_Normal: aBuffer.Append("normal"); break;
case eCSSUnit_String: break;
case eCSSUnit_Integer: break;
case eCSSUnit_Enumerated: break;
case eCSSUnit_Color: break;
case eCSSUnit_Percent: aBuffer.Append("%"); break;
case eCSSUnit_Number: break;
case eCSSUnit_Inch: aBuffer.Append("in"); break;
case eCSSUnit_Foot: aBuffer.Append("ft"); break;
case eCSSUnit_Mile: aBuffer.Append("mi"); break;
case eCSSUnit_Millimeter: aBuffer.Append("mm"); break;
case eCSSUnit_Centimeter: aBuffer.Append("cm"); break;
case eCSSUnit_Meter: aBuffer.Append("m"); break;
case eCSSUnit_Kilometer: aBuffer.Append("km"); break;
case eCSSUnit_Point: aBuffer.Append("pt"); break;
case eCSSUnit_Pica: aBuffer.Append("pc"); break;
case eCSSUnit_Didot: aBuffer.Append("dt"); break;
case eCSSUnit_Cicero: aBuffer.Append("cc"); break;
case eCSSUnit_EM: aBuffer.Append("em"); break;
case eCSSUnit_EN: aBuffer.Append("en"); break;
case eCSSUnit_XHeight: aBuffer.Append("ex"); break;
case eCSSUnit_CapHeight: aBuffer.Append("cap"); break;
case eCSSUnit_Pixel: aBuffer.Append("px"); break;
}
}
nsresult CSSDeclarationImpl::ToString(nsString& aString)
{
if (nsnull != mOrder) {
PRInt32 count = mOrder->Count();
PRInt32 index;
for (index = 0; index < count; index++) {
PRInt32 property = (PRInt32)mOrder->ElementAt(index);
if (0 <= property) {
nsCSSValue value;
PRBool important = PR_FALSE;
// check for important value
if (nsnull != mImportant) {
mImportant->GetValue(property, value);
if (eCSSUnit_Null != value.GetUnit()) {
important = PR_TRUE;
}
else {
GetValue(property, value);
}
}
else {
GetValue(property, value);
}
aString.Append(nsCSSProps::kNameTable[property].name);
aString.Append(": ");
ValueToString(value, property, aString);
if (PR_TRUE == important) {
aString.Append(" ! important");
}
aString.Append("; ");
}
else { // is comment
aString.Append("/* ");
nsString* comment = (nsString*)mComments->ElementAt((-1) - property);
aString.Append(*comment);
aString.Append(" */ ");
}
}
}
return NS_OK;
}
